Hello,
I'm thinking about migrate my MGMT Server and SmartEvent from Gaia R77.30 to R80.30 (leaveing GW on R77.30) and Im wondering did can use same methods described here:
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=egAIQqMUOPE
I know that R80.30 is pretty new so I would like to avoid some unexpected problems :(.
Also, there is any step-by-step instruction of migrating SmartEvent from R77.30 to R80.30 ?
Best Wishes 🙂
I'd stay away from R80.30 if you're using PBR or you need to turn off SecureXL (reboot persistent) for any reason. Everything else works fine so far, we have several GWs/Management Server R80.30 with 3.10 Kernel on Open Server hardware and VMs.
That said, you can always keep your old Management Server as a backup if something goes horribly wrong. sk110173 goes into detail about the SmartEvent migration from R7X to R8X.
You should upgrade both management and gateways to R80.X asap since support for R77.30 ended september 2019 according to https://www.checkpoint.com/support-services/support-life-cycle-policy/. The methods in the video should work, but you should still take special care to validate the location of important configuration files like vpn_route.conf and table.def.

Hi Nickel
Can you elaborate on your comment about PBR? what was your experience with it? do you find it degraded compare to older releases?
Thanks in advance.
Yair
Hi Yair,
PBR stopped working altogether after we upgraded from R80.10 to R80.30. TAC is already involved, but we don't have a solution yet, so I can't say if its a bug or a hardware issue etc.
Best Regards,
Update on my Case:
After updating to Hotfix Version R76 AND creating a second PBR rule for the NATed IP everything works fine now.
